The Role of a Car Locksmith

A car locksmith, likewise referred to as an automotive locksmith, is an expert who concentrates on the security of cars. Their primary obligations consist of:

  1. Key Duplication: Creating duplicate keys for vehicle owners, typically when the original key is lost or harmed.
  2. Key Programming: Programming electronic or chip keys for modern-day automobiles that require specific coding to run.
  3. Lock Repair and Replacement: Fixing or changing damaged locks on car doors, trunks, and ignition systems.
  4. Lockout Assistance: Helping vehicle owners who have been locked out of their cars and trucks, offering quick and efficient gain access to.
  5. Security Consultation: Advising clients on the very best methods to protect their cars against theft and unauthorized access.
  6. Setup of Security Systems: Installing sophisticated security systems, such as immobilizers and alarms, to improve vehicle protection.

The Tools of the Trade

Car locksmith professionals utilize a variety of specialized tools to perform their jobs. A few of the most common tools consist of:

  • Key Machines: These makers are used to cut and replicate keys accurately.
  • Choose Sets: Sets of lock choices utilized to manipulate the pins inside a lock and open it without a key.
  • Decoders: Devices that read the special codes of chip keys, permitting cheap locksmith near me for cars professionals to program new keys.
  • Drill Rigs: Used as a last resort to drill out locks that can not be picked or have been damaged beyond repair.
  • Laptop computer and Software: For programming and identifying issues with electronic locks and security systems.
  • Telescopic Mirrors: These mirrors assistance locksmith professionals see into tight spaces, such as keyholes, to better comprehend the lock system.
  • Tension Wrenches: Tools utilized to use the essential stress to a lock while picking it.

Challenges Faced by Car Locksmiths

Regardless of the high demand for their services, car locksmith professionals deal with a number of obstacles:

  1. Technological Advancements: Modern cars frequently feature advanced security functions, such as keyless entry and clever keys, which need specialized understanding and tools.
  2. Security Risks: Locksmiths should be watchful about security risks, including the possibility of their services being utilized for prohibited activities.
  3. Regulatory Compliance: Navigating the legal and regulative landscape, which can vary by region, is a consistent obstacle.
  4. Client Trust: Building and preserving trust with customers is essential, specifically when handling delicate details and access to individual home.

FAQs About Car Locksmiths

  1. How do I discover a trusted car locksmith?

    • Search for locksmiths with great evaluations and a strong credibility. Examine if they are certified and insured. You can likewise ask for recommendations from pals, family, or local automotive forums.
  2. Can a car locksmith open a car without a key?

    • Yes, car locksmith professionals are trained to open automobiles without causing damage. They utilize lock selecting, key extraction, and other strategies to acquire access.
  3. How long does it take to get a brand-new key made?

    • The time it requires to make a brand-new key depends on the complexity of the lock and the kind of key. Easy mechanical keys can be made in a couple of minutes, while electronic keys might take an hour or more.
  4. What should I do if I lose my car keys?

    • Contact a relied on car locksmith immediately. They can supply a new key and help you secure your vehicle. It's likewise a good idea to report the lost keys to your insurance coverage business and the authorities, especially if you presume foul play.
  5. Are car locksmiths covered by insurance coverage?

    • Lots of insurance coverage policies cover the cost of locksmith services if the requirement emerges due to a covered occurrence, such as a burglary. Check your policy to see if locksmith services are included.
  6. Can a car locksmith aid with a broken type in the ignition?

    • Yes, car locksmiths can extract broken keys from locks and replace the key or the lock if essential.
